Abstract
The present invention relates to the building methods of a kind of distributed energy transaction communications platform based on block chain technology, communication means and communications platform.Communications platform includes three layers: hardware layer, application layer and block link layer, hardware layer includes hair/electrical equipment of user, intelligent electric meter and intelligent terminal, block link layer includes intelligent contract, intelligent contract is the trading rules of digital form, application layer is by web front-end, the Distributed Application that the rear end js and the rear end Python are constituted, for realizing hardware layer, application layer and block link layer are in communication with each other, web front-end be used for receive user input declare information and Transaction Information, the rear end js far call intelligence contract, information and Transaction Information are declared in input, the rear end Python far call intelligence contract, input information about power.Technical solution of the present invention realizes the communications of prosumer's information in distributed energy trade market, achievees the effect that multi-information fusion communicates, shortens the communication response time, realizes the efficient distribution of the energy, rationally utilizes.

Specific embodiment
It is described further below with reference to technical effect of the attached drawing to design of the invention, specific structure and generation, with
It is fully understood from the purpose of the present invention, feature and effect.
With reference to Fig. 1 and Fig. 2, a kind of distributed energy transaction communications platform based on block chain technology of the invention, including
The layers of three interoperability: hardware layer, application layer and block link layer, hardware layer include hair/electrical equipment of user, intelligent electric meter and
Intelligent terminal, user, that is, electric power energy producers and consumers (hereinafter referred to as prosumer) herein, intelligent electric meter is mounted on
In hair/electrical equipment, and it is connected with intelligent terminal, for measuring and transmitting information about power to intelligent terminal, intelligent terminal is micro-
Type computer, is the physical support of application layer and block link layer, and application layer and block link layer operate on intelligent terminal.
Block link layer includes data storage, network communication, common recognition algorithm, intelligent contract, wherein data are stored for storing
Data in block chain, data information are saved within a block in the form of Merkel tree, form chain between block sequentially in time
Formula structure.Network communication is used to connect the user node in block chain, realizes the propagation of information.The common recognition machine that algorithm of knowing together provides
System can allow the node in network to generate accounting nodes by competition, reach distributed common recognition.Intelligent contract is the friendship of digital form
Easily rule, carries reception, operation, storage and the feedback function of Transaction Information, for realizing energy distributed transaction.
Application layer is the Distributed Application being made of web front-end, the rear end js and the rear end Python, for realizing hardware layer,
Application layer and block link layer are in communication with each other.The function of web front-end and the rear end js carrying customer transaction information transmission, web front-end
The interactive interface that user and transaction system are shown by intelligent terminal, declare information and transaction for receiving user's input are believed
Breath.Medium of the rear end js between web front-end and block chain is declared information and Transaction Information from web front-end reading, and is remotely adjusted
Information and Transaction Information are declared with intelligent contract, input.Medium of the rear end Python between intelligent electric meter and block chain, carrying
Information about power is read from intelligent electric meter in the function of user's information about power transmission, Python rear end of the operation on intelligent terminal, and
Far call intelligence contract, input information about power.
In hardware layer, hair/electrical equipment compatibility of user preferably, does not limit user as the monistic producer or consumption
Person allows user freely to convert the identity of prosumer.Intelligent electric meter is that DTZY208 type three-phase and four-line takes control intelligent electric meter, has 1
A infrared communication interface, 1 RS485 communication interface and 1 carrier communication interface, intelligent electric meter turn USB interface by RS485
Converter is connect with intelligent terminal, to transmit hair/electricity consumption information.RS485 interface has good noise immunity, compared with
The advantages that long transmission range.Intelligent electric meter follows DL/T645-2007 " multi -function watt -hour meter communication protocol " and its text of putting on record
Part, the communication protocol are the half-duplex operation mode of main-slave structure, and handheld unit or other data terminals are main website, multi-functional
Ammeter is slave station, and slave station sends information to main website by DL/T645-2007 agreement.Each multifunction electric meter has respectively
Location coding, foundation and the releasing of communication link are controlled by the information frame that main website issues.Every frame is by start-of-frame, tributary address
Domain, control code, data field length, data field, frame information longitudinal check code and frame end accord with 7 domain compositions, and every part is by several
Byte composition.
In block link layer, it is based on the public block chain development platform in ether mill, using the primary data storage in ether mill, network
Communication means and common recognition algorithm, create the privately owned chain in ether mill.Use ether mill client geth as block chain user node, ginseng
With the market behavior.Write the complete intelligent contract of figure spirit using Solidity programming language, specify market prosumer right and
Obligation realizes the intelligence of information transmission, so that information can not distort.Ether mill is current most popular public block chain
Platform, bottom are the P2P network platforms of a similar bit coin network.Intelligent contract operates in the ether mill P2P network platform,
It can receive from external communication request, by triggering code logic, further feedback information.
In application layer, web front-end is developed using html programming language, after developing js using JavaScript programming language
The rear end Python is developed using Python programming language in end, and the rear end js passes through the jQuery frame and web front-end of JavaScript
Intelligent contract is called using far call agreement JSON-RPC in communication, the rear end js, transmits Transaction Information, and the rear end Python uses remote
Journey invocation protocol JSON-RPC calls intelligent contract, transmits information about power, realizes the data of application layer and hardware layer, block link layer
Communication.Application layer carries main communication function, user using Distributed Application by Transaction Information, generate the/electricity of electrical equipment
Information incoming block chain simultaneously is measured, multi-network cooperative communication, configuration information physics converged communication system are reached.

With reference to Fig. 3 and Fig. 4, a kind of distributed energy transaction communications platform based on block chain technology of the invention is built
Method, comprising the following steps:
S1: building hardware layer, and three-phase and four-line expense control intelligent electric meter is mounted in hair/electrical equipment of user, and is passed through
RS485 turns the converter of USB interface, connects with intelligent terminal;
S2: building block link layer, installs and runs ether mill client geth, the privately owned chain in ether mill is built, according to specific
Market trading facility write intelligent contract, specify the rights and duties of market prosumer, use ether mill client geth will
Intelligent contract is deployed in ether mill network;
S3: building application layer, realizes being in communication with each other for hardware layer, application layer and block link layer:
S31: intelligent contract original code is compiled as web3 interface code, the rear end js and the rear end Python is programmed into, passes through
Ether mill client geth calls intelligent contract, realizes that intelligent contract and block chain are communicated with the information of external environment;
S32: according to specifically used environment, web front-end is developed using html programming language, uses JavaScript programming language
The speech exploitation rear end js;
S33: according to specifically used environment and used intelligent electric meter, after developing Python using Python programming language
End.
With reference to Fig. 5, a kind of distributed energy transaction communications method based on block chain technology of the invention, including following step
It is rapid:
S1: user is inputted in intelligent terminal by the graphical interaction interface of web front-end and declares information and Transaction Information, after js
Information and Transaction Information are declared from web front-end acquisition by jQuery frame in end, and the rear end js passes through JSON-RPC and ether mill visitor
Intelligent contract is called in geth interaction in family end, will declare in information and Transaction Information deposit block chain;
S2: the information about power that intelligent electric meter is read in the rear end Python on intelligent terminal is operated in, the rear end Python passes through
JSON-RPC is interacted with ether mill client geth, calls intelligent contract, and information about power is stored in block chain, specifically include with
Lower step (referring to Fig. 6):
S21: receive: the rear end Python receives a string of 16 system messages of intelligent electric meter transmission;
S22: transcoding: field related with electricity in message is extracted in the rear end Python, carries out 10 system transcodings, obtains accurate
2 10 system electricity after to decimal point, due to intelligent contract can only to integer carry out operation, by this number multiplied by
100;
S23: sending: Python and copy rear end the grammer call format of geth console intelligence contract, selection accordingly with
Too mill account calls intelligent contract, information about power is stored in block chain.
S3: by Web broadcast to each of block chain node, node in block chain will receive intelligent contract
Information preservation in memory, waits the common recognition time of a new round, triggers common recognition and processing to contract;
S4: when reaching the time of knowing together, intelligent contract is declared information according to user and is brought together transaction, for making for the first time
With the new user of the platform, it is for reference that system provides the user with current electric grid electricity price;Repeatedly after transaction, intelligent contract be will record
And the case history conclusion of the business electricity price range for regularly updating all users provides a user accurate Shen according to marketing situation
Report suggests that user can rationally be declared according to this information, and the final efficient distribution for realizing the energy rationally utilizes.
S5: all contracts handled in nearest a period of time are packaged into a contract set by node, are set with Merck more
Form saves within a block, forms chain structure between block sequentially in time.It is a kind of binary tree, all friendships that Merck is set more
Easy information is all recorded on the leaf node of binary tree.
